Rye Fire Station open day

FIREFIGHTERS in Rye held an open day at the fire station on Sunday and raised hundreds of pounds for charity.
Children had the chance to sit in the fire engines and learn about fire safety.There were also stalls selling cakes as well as a raffle and tombola.
Andy Polley, watch commander, said more than £2,300 had been raised so far for the Fire Service Charity (formally the Fire Service Benevolent Fund), through the culmination of the open day, raffle and recent firefighters' ball at The Mermaid Inn.
